VirtualBox

Changeset 3086 in vbox for trunk/src/VBox/Main


Ignore:
Timestamp:
Jun 11, 2007 8:43:47 AM (18 years ago)
Author:
vboxsync
svn:sync-xref-src-repo-rev:
21943
Message:

introduced RTLogCreateEx and RTLogCreateExV to be able to pass an error string back to the caller

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/src/VBox/Main/ConsoleImpl.cpp

    r3045 r3086  
    65556555        fFlags |= RTLOGFLAGS_USECRLF;
    65566556#endif /* __WIN__ */
    6557         vrc = RTLogCreate(&loggerRelease, fFlags, "all",
    6558                           "VBOX_RELEASE_LOG", ELEMENTS(s_apszGroups), s_apszGroups,
    6559                           RTLOGDEST_FILE, logFile.raw());
     6557        char szError[RTPATH_MAX + 128] = "";
     6558        vrc = RTLogCreateEx(&loggerRelease, fFlags, "all",
     6559                            "VBOX_RELEASE_LOG", ELEMENTS(s_apszGroups), s_apszGroups,
     6560                            RTLOGDEST_FILE, szError, sizeof(szError), logFile.raw());
    65606561        if (VBOX_SUCCESS(vrc))
    65616562        {
     
    65766577        {
    65776578            hrc = setError (E_FAIL,
    6578                 tr ("Failed to open release log file '%s' (%Vrc)"),
    6579                 logFile.raw(), vrc);
     6579                tr ("Failed to open release log (%s, %Vrc)"), szError, vrc);
    65806580            break;
    65816581        }
Note: See TracChangeset for help on using the changeset viewer.

© 2025 Oracle Support Privacy / Do Not Sell My Info Terms of Use Trademark Policy Automated Access Etiquette